The vent tubes on the main body of my 8082 dominator... are they set at a certain height for a reason? my front vent is higher than the rear and is causing interference with my air cleaner lid. I'm trying to SQUEEZE my 16" air cleaner under my hood and have drastically cut my Indy intake for fitment and have bought a 2" drop base to make it fit with a 3.5" filter and it would probably fit without the tubes sticking up. With the tubes sitting up 3/4" above the main body a 4" element can BARELY be forced to work with slight hood interference.
Can the tubes be shortened- and if so- how much?
I'm running a K&N flow thru lid and it has a flat metal screen across the bottom- not domed as it may appear on the bottom so the tubes cannot fit up inside the lid.
No matter what base or height of filter I use clearing the vents is a problem before I hit the hood.... I might drop the K member but I am not cutting this hood(yes I'm being totally stubborn )
